Q: Is 1,567,824 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,567,824 is a composite number.

Why is 1,567,824 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,567,824 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 89 178 267 356 367 534 712 734 1,068 1,101 1,424 1,468 2,136 2,202 2,936 4,272 4,404 5,872 8,808 17,616 32,663 65,326 97,989 130,652 195,978 261,304 391,956 522,608 783,912 and 1,567,824, with no remainder.

Since 1,567,824 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,567,824, it is a composite number.
